| Abstract: | The aim of this work is the development of a digital platform
to support the physical rehabilitation of stroke patients who were cleared
to transition to home-based and outpatient rehabilitation.
This digital solution facilitates real-time communication with physiother-
apists, disseminates stroke educational content to boost patient health
literacy, and complements rehabilitation protocols through guided exer-
cise videos and session monitoring (including repetition counts, schedul-
ing, and time tracking).
The development consisted of a Progressive Web Application (PWA), a
hybrid solution functioning as both a web browser application and a na-
tive app. Its layered architecture isolates UI components from backend
operations. By combining modern and robust technologies, we created
an accessible and secure application capable of real-time communica-
tion between users and physiotherapists. This streamlines rehabilitation
activity tracking and enhances patient well-being. In-situ evaluation is
scheduled for the subsequent project phase, to be carried out through
partnerships with healthcare providers. |
